Barium titanate (BaTiOj), a perovskite-type electro-ceramic material, has been extensively studied and utilized due to its dielectric and ferroelectric properties. The wide applications of barium titanates include multiplayer capacitors in electronic circuits, nonlinear resistors, thermal switches, passive memory storage devices, and transducers. In addition, barium titanate can be used for chemical sensors due to its surface sensivity to gas adsorption. [Pg.211]

Diopside. Mg0.Ca0.2Si02 m.p. 1392°C sp. gr. 3.3 thermal expansion (0-1200 C) 8.8 X10-6. There is a deposit in New York State. Trials have been made with synthetic diopside as a high-frequency electro-ceramic. It is formed as a devitrification product of sodalime glass if the CaO is partially replaced by MgO it is also formed when siliceous slags attack dolomite refractories. [Pg.92]
